Today on ICYMI, we are going to talk about the Realme X50 Pro 5G and also the OPPO Find X2’s launch. Both of these devices are powered by Qualcomm’s latest chipset, which is the Snapdragon 865 .

Realme X50 Pro 5G

Realme has just unveiled its ultimate flagship smartphone yet with its Realme X50 Pro 5G. Learn more about it here.

Samsung Galaxy Buds+ Malaysia

The Samsung Galaxy S20 series will be going on sale next week but if you want to own Samsung’s latest true wireless earphones, the Galaxy Buds+ are now available throughout Malaysia.

Oppo Find X2 Malaysian launch

The Oppo Find X2 will be revealed next week and it will feature Qualcomm’s latest Snapdragon 865 processor. The device will also be launched in Malaysia few days after its global debut. Click here to learn more.

GrabCar users can add extra Ride Cover protection at RM0.35 per ride

For greater peace of mind, Grab has introduced Ride Cover which is an optional insurance package that provides additional protection for GrabCar users in Malaysia at only RM0.35 per ride.
